ID   EIIL
AC   CVCL_W441
DR   cancercelllines; CVCL_W441
DR   Wikidata; Q54832166
RX   PubMed=7699285;
RX   PubMed=8718550;
RX   PubMed=10381137;
CC   Population: Japanese.
CC   Characteristics: Estrogen-independent (PubMed=7699285).
CC   Sequence variation: Mutation; HGNC; 8979; PIK3R1; Simple; p.Leu570Pro (c.1709T>C); Zygosity=Heterozygous (from parent cell line).
CC   Sequence variation: Mutation; HGNC; 9177; POLE; Simple; p.Pro102Ser (c.304C>T); Zygosity=Heterozygous (from parent cell line).
CC   Sequence variation: Mutation; HGNC; 9177; POLE; Simple; p.Asn751fs (c.2252delA); Zygosity=Heterozygous (from parent cell line).
CC   Sequence variation: Mutation; HGNC; 9588; PTEN; Simple; p.Glu288fs*3 (c.863delA); Zygosity=Heterozygous (from parent cell line).
CC   Sequence variation: Mutation; HGNC; 9588; PTEN; Simple; p.Thr319fs*1 (c.950_953delTACT) (p.VL317fs) (V317fs*3); Zygosity=Heterozygous (from parent cell line).
CC   Sequence variation: Mutation; HGNC; 11998; TP53; Simple; p.Asp49His (c.145G>C); ClinVar=VCV000135948; Zygosity=Heterozygous (from parent cell line).
CC   Sequence variation: Mutation; HGNC; 11998; TP53; Simple; p.Met246Val (c.736A>G); ClinVar=VCV000100815; Zygosity=Heterozygous (from parent cell line).
CC   Derived from site: In situ; Endometrium; UBERON=UBERON_0001295.
DI   NCIt; C7359; Endometrial adenocarcinoma
OX   NCBI_TaxID=9606; ! Homo sapiens (Human)
HI   CVCL_2529 ! Ishikawa
SX   Female
AG   39Y
CA   Cancer cell line
DT   Created: 16-04-14; Last updated: 05-10-23; Version: 10
